Tiny Vehicle Electric Motor Performance Metrics



In assessing the performance of small automobile motors, crucial metrics such as acceleration, gas effectiveness, and power outcome play a crucial role in identifying their total efficiency and viability for different driving conditions. Acceleration, gauged in seconds from 0 to 60 miles per hour, shows just how quickly a small automobile can get to higher speeds, which is vital for combining onto highways or overtaking other lorries. Gas performance, generally measured in miles per gallon (MPG), mirrors exactly how far a tiny automobile can travel on a gallon of gas, affecting running expenses and environmental sustainability. Power result, shared in horsepower (HP) or kilowatts (kW), signifies the engine's ability to create the required force to propel the vehicle, influencing its efficiency in various roadway conditions. Horsepower and Torque Evaluation



With an essential role in understanding small cars and truck motor horse power, efficiency and torque evaluation offers understanding right into the engine's power distribution characteristics. Horse power is a measurement of the engine's ability to do function over time, standing for the price at which work is done. In the context of little cars and truck motors, horse power is vital for determining velocity, full throttle, and general efficiency. Torque, on the various other hand, gauges the engine's rotational pressure, suggesting its capability to get rid of resistance. Little car engines with greater torque values commonly feel more responsive and supply better velocity, making them suitable for city driving and overtaking maneuvers. Fuel Efficiency Evaluation



The examination of gas performance in little car motors plays an essential function in determining their environmental and financial effect. Fuel performance refers to the capability of a lorry to utilize fuel successfully in regard to the distance traveled. In little cars and truck motors, where portable dimension commonly associates with much better gas economic situation, numerous elements affect efficiency. Engine style, weight, the rules of aerodynamics, and driving conditions all add to how successfully fuel is eaten.


Little auto electric motors that attain greater MPG ratings are thought about more fuel-efficient, resulting in price savings for drivers and minimized discharges that benefit the atmosphere. Manufacturers continually make every effort to enhance gas efficiency with advancements in engine innovation, light-weight products, and aerodynamic styles.
